Headline rent vs. effective rent

Asking rents in Luxembourg are quoted in EUR per sqft per year. Across the broad Class A index the figure is 50, but the trophy tier in Kirchberg reaches roughly €56/sqm/mo · ≈ $67.4 PSF/yr USD. Always discount headline rent by the present value of free rent and fit-out-capex">tenant improvement allowance to land on effective rent — the only number that compares cleanly across deals.

Rent-free and TI

Standard Luxembourg concessions on a 9-year Class A lease run to 6 months of base-rent abatement. Trophy lease-ups can push rent-free 25–40% above that benchmark. Local cost-of-occupancy is also shaped by tax — 17% federal corporate income tax plus 7% solidarity surcharge plus 6.75% Luxembourg City municipal business tax for an effective combined rate of 24.94%. Where rents land by submarket

Kirchberg sits at the top end (~€56/sqm/mo · ≈ $67.4 PSF/yr USD). Gare District clears around €44/sqm/mo · ≈ $53 PSF/yr USD as the prime tier. Esch-Belval represents the value end at ~€28/sqm/mo · ≈ $33.7 PSF/yr USD. The full submarket map is on the Luxembourg city page.
